CRITERIA NOT COVERED BY WARRANTY
Stretching beyond its maximum length of 2.5 times its resting length (by not using the handles and
shortening your grip, knotting, or tying round a pole or similar)
Cosmetic wear to the surface from regular use that does not affect the performance of the
SMARTBAND
Damage from shoes or abrasive floor surfaces including outside elements or factors
Uneven colour patterns, stains, or discolouration at time of purchase or from use or storage
Creases, folds, and indentations from improper handling and/or storing. It is best to hang the
SMARTBAND or keep it rolled up.
Improper cleaning with anything other than water with a mild detergent
Damage from sharp objects
Damage from excessive amounts of water or other liquids (e.g. submerging under water or using a
water blaster)
